Bile - Definition - Law Dictionary Home Dictionary Definition bile

Definition :

A yellow or greenish viscid fluid usually alkaline in reaction secreted by the liver It passes into the intestines where it aids in the digestive process Its characteristic constituents are the bile salts and coloring matters
